The problem is that the frame is not flush with the body rail.

If you got one of those original automag Z-grips you will need to file off the wings in the back so the whole frame sits flush with the body rail.

The original Z grips made for the automag will not fit RT pros without modification.

It looks as if this is the case.

You can save yourself some cash by doing that first. Thats what AGD is probably gonna do for you anyway.

You have an Automag Z-Grip that has the wings on the sides of the frame to fit the contour of the Mag rail. You need to get those wings filed off by either putting it in a vertical mill and using and endmill to cut them down flush with the rest of the gripframe surface, you can do it by hand, your you can send it in to AGD and have them fix it for you.

That is your problem without question. Don't use your gun anymore because you'll just risk putting excess wear on the sear and bolt.
